Output baabea0666f03067b3da365c013c3c73b6ed8d12a5902a0ebc8f18ba803b4e17:1

value
5987023
script pubkey
OP_0 OP_PUSHBYTES_20 22943ec33c38a08894dee27fcd4289718be99d28
address
bc1qy22raseu8zsg39x7uflu6s5fwx97n8fgsyym0x
transaction
baabea0666f03067b3da365c013c3c73b6ed8d12a5902a0ebc8f18ba803b4e17
confirmations
54508
spent
true